How To Protect A Dining Room Table
Dining room tables are often the centerpiece of a home, and they can be expensive to replace. That's why it's important to take steps to protect your dining room table from damage. Here are a few tips:
Use a tablecloth or placemats. This is the most basic way to protect your table from scratches, spills, and heat damage. Choose a tablecloth or placemats that are made from a durable material, such as cotton, linen, or vinyl. You can also find tablecloths and placemats that are treated with a stain-resistant finish.
Use coasters under drinks. Condensation from drinks can damage the finish on your table. To prevent this, always use coasters under your drinks. Coasters are available in a variety of materials, including cork, felt, and ceramic.
Be careful with hot dishes. Never place hot dishes directly on your table. Always use a trivet or hot pad to protect the finish.
Clean your table regularly. Dust and dirt can build up on your table over time, which can damage the finish. To prevent this, clean your table regularly with a soft cloth and a mild cleaner. Avoid using harsh cleaners or abrasive materials, as these can damage the finish.
Repair scratches immediately. If you do get a scratch on your table, it's important to repair it immediately. This will help to prevent the scratch from getting worse and causing further damage to the finish.
Protect your table from sunlight. Sunlight can damage the finish on your table over time. To prevent this, keep your table out of direct sunlight. If you have a window near your table, cover it with curtains or blinds when you're not using it.
By following these tips, you can help to protect your dining room table from damage and keep it looking its best for years to come.
